Ugly Betty Episode 2.13 Video Sneak Peek

by Tom on January 22nd, 2008

Ugly Betty 2.13 Henry Betty Gio

Here is a sneak peek video of Ugly Betty episode 2.13, “A Thousand Words By Friday”.  The Henry/Betty/Gio love triangle is in full force here, and of course both of the men have a little attack of macho bravado.

Are the writers (I guess I should say WERE the writers…) trying to steer the audience to stop liking Henry, so the blow will be softened when he leaves?  I know many of you are Henry/Betty fans, but Gio has seemed more and more sympathetic lately.  Regardless, this storyline is going to be hilarious!  Add in the Amanda/Gene Simmons story, and you’ve got an episode that is not to be missed!
